Originally Posted by Kuya_Kimo
What's the difference between the C-XERUN and the XERUN found on hobbypartz.com? My SCTE's RX8 has taken a dump again (1,2,6,7 led)... I loved my Orion r10 pro and Xerun 1s v2.1 in my SCTE but always went back to the RX8 because I'm already invested.

http://www.hobbypartz.com/07e-c-xerun-120a-sd.html
2-3s, 120amp, ?

http://www.hobbypartz.com/07e-xerun-...-1s-black.html
1-2s, 120amp, ?

Any real-world help/suggestions would be helpful!
Brod,

Almost similar,only difference are the input voltage 1s being 1-2 cell with lower BEC amp output and the other one can take 2-3 cell with a much higher BEC output,if you are not going to use more than 2 cell lipo then 1s is ok ,check your servo rating if the BEC can provide the needed power,else you can get an external BEC/ glitch. Buster to eliminate some glitch issue from HV Servos.
